Climate Considerations



When preparing a commercial paint task, climate factors to consider are vital. You require to keep an eye on temperature level and moisture degrees, as they can substantially affect paint application and drying times.

Ideally, you wish to schedule your project throughout mild weather-- tem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F are usually best for most paints. Severe warmth can cause the paint to dry too swiftly, leading to cracks, while reduced temperature levels can decrease drying, enabling dirt and particles to settle on the damp surface area.

Rain is an additional aspect to think about. Paint outside throughout damp conditions can cause inadequate bond and a greater chance of peeling off later. It's important to inspect the projection and strategy your task for a stretch of completely dry days.

Wind can additionally be a concern, particularly if you're working with spray paint, as it can trigger overspray and uneven coverage.

Finally, seasonal adjustments can modify your timeline. Spring and fall typically offer the most beneficial problems, so think about these periods when arranging your industrial painting project.

Off-Peak Business Hours



Scheduling your business painting task throughout off-peak business hours can considerably reduce disturbances. Selecting times when your company is much less active enables your employees and customers to continue without interruption. Typically, mornings, late afternoons, or weekend breaks work as optimal slots for this kind of work.

By scheduling your task during these times, you not just ensure a smoother procedure yet additionally improve the quality of the job. Painters can work more successfully when they're not rushing to avoid foot traffic. You'll find that paint dries better and coatings look cleaner without the consistent motion of people nearby.



Additionally, using off-peak hours can aid you maintain your company's track record. Clients value an efficient environment, and reducing noise and disruption reveals that you respect their experience.

Remember to connect your routine with the painting contractors. Let them know your company hours so they can intend appropriately. This partnership can bring about better results and a more enjoyable experience for everybody included.
